The Property

Dunfermline Carnegie Library & Galleries – a new museum, gallery spaces, cafe, shop and reading rooms all adjoining the world’s 1st Carnegie Library.

This spectacular £12.4million award-winning new building (EAA Building of the Year, Royal Incorporation of Architects in Scotland’s (RIAS) Andrew Doolan prize), which opened in May 2017, links superbly with the world’s first Carnegie Library and houses a new museum, exhibition galleries, local history Reading Room, new children’s library and a mezzanine café with stunning views over the landscaped garden to Dunfermline Abbey and the Heritage Quarter.

As one of Scotland’s former ancient capitals, Dunfermline has both a remarkable royal history and an impressive industrial heritage. Dunfermline’s past is brought to life in the new museum with fascinating stories retold through a series of special films, inspiring interviews, engaging computer games and, of course, our collections.

Cafe

The café is run by Heaven Scent, offering a delicious selection of home-made cakes, scones, light snacks such as soup and sandwiches, barista coffee and tea on a self-service basis.

In keeping with the Heaven Scent ethos, products and ingredients are sourced as locally, ethically and seasonally as possible. The café caters for vegetarians. vegans and customers on a gluten-free diet, and there are fun, flexible options for children.
